Prince Charles presents medals to Mercian Regiment on their return from Afghanistan
Clarence House, February 6 (Camilla watched the ceremony from the Balcony) Fotobanka isifa image service __________________________________________ HRH presents Operation Herrick medals to soldiers at Clarence House upon theit return from Afghanistan 6th February 2008 The Prince of Wales today presented soldiers from the Mercian regiment with their Afghan campaign medals after inviting them to Clarence House for a reception. (...) As The Prince moved among immaculately turned out servicemen dressed in their khaki uniforms, he was watched from a balcony by The Duchess of Cornwall.
